CHICKEN-BROCCOLI STIR FRY 
1 lb. boneless skinless chicken breasts
1 lb. fresh broccoli
1 sm. onion
1 tbsp. ground ginger
2 tbsp. cornstarch
3-4 carrots
3 1/2 tbsp. soy sauce
1/4 tsp. garlic powder
1 1/4 c. water

Cut chicken into bite size pieces. Place in small bowl and add ginger, garlic powder, 1 tbsp. cornstarch and 1 1/2 tbsp. soy sauce. Mix and set aside.

Chop broccoli and onion. Slice carrots diagonally. In hot wok or skillet, stir fry chicken in 2 tbsp. oil until browned. Add vegetables and stir fry 2-3 minutes. Add water mixed with remaining soy sauce and cornstarch. Cover and cook 5 to 8 minutes or until carrots are semi-tender. Serve over rice.
